Basal-Bolus Insulin Schedule

Basal-Bolus Insulin Schedule

💾 Basal-Bolus Insulin Schedule .xls

A basal-bolus insulin schedule is an intensive insulin therapy regimen designed to mimic the natural physiological rhythm of the pancreas. This management template utilizes long-acting insulin (basal) to provide a steady background of glucose control during fasting or sleep, alongside rapid-acting insulin (bolus) administered at mealtimes. This dual-action approach is essential for maintaining stable blood glucose levels and preventing postprandial spikes.

To optimize glycemic control, patients often track the following variables:

  • Carbohydrate counting: Calculating bolus units based on nutritional intake.
  • Correction factors: Adjusting dosages for unexpected hyperglycemia.
  • Glucose monitoring: Tracking patterns via fingersticks or continuous monitors.

This flexible delivery framework allows individuals with Type 1 or Type 2 diabetes to achieve better A1c results and metabolic stability by tailoring insulin delivery to their specific lifestyle, exercise habits, and dietary needs.

Type 1 Diabetes Carb and Insulin Calculator

Type 1 Diabetes Carb and Insulin Calculator

💾 Type 1 Diabetes Carb and Insulin Calculator .xls

Managing Type 1 Diabetes requires precise bolus calculations to maintain stable blood glucose levels. This interface simplifies the process by integrating carbohydrate intake with personal insulin sensitivity factors. By inputting total grams of carbohydrates and your specific insulin-to-carb ratio, the tool determines the necessary dose for food consumption.

The calculator also accounts for correction doses. It evaluates the variance between current and target glucose levels, dividing the difference by your insulin sensitivity factor. This combined calculation ensures accurate dosing for both meals and glucose corrections, supporting better long-term glycemic control.

Insulin Sensitivity Factor Log

Insulin Sensitivity Factor Log

💾 Insulin Sensitivity Factor Log .xls

An Insulin Sensitivity Factor (ISF) Log is an essential instrument for precision diabetes management. Often referred to as a correction factor, the ISF quantifies how many milligrams per deciliter (mg/dL) or millimoles per liter (mmol/L) your blood glucose level drops following the administration of one unit of rapid-acting insulin. Maintaining a detailed log assists individuals with Type 1 or Type 2 diabetes in achieving superior glycemic control while preventing hyperglycemia.

By documenting pre-meal glucose, insulin dosages, and postprandial results, users can fine-tune their bolus calculator settings. This structured template identifies patterns in insulin response, ensuring blood sugar monitoring remains within the target range. Utilizing these data points allows healthcare providers to optimize your carbohydrate-to-insulin ratio, ultimately reducing glycemic variability and improving long-term metabolic health through data-driven adjustments.

Sliding Scale Insulin Chart

Sliding Scale Insulin Chart

💾 Sliding Scale Insulin Chart .xls

A sliding scale insulin chart serves as a vital clinical tool for personalized diabetes management. This template outlines specific rapid-acting insulin dosages based on real-time blood glucose levels. By utilizing glucometer readings, patients can determine the precise correction dose required to treat hyperglycemia effectively. Unlike fixed-dose regimens, sliding scale insulin therapy adjusts the bolus insulin amount in response to pre-meal or bedtime sugar elevations.

This reactive approach ensures glycemic control by categorizing blood sugar ranges into actionable steps. Healthcare providers use these charts to simplify insulin sensitivity adjustments, helping to prevent long-term complications. Implementing a well-structured insulin dosage table facilitates accurate medication administration, allowing for immediate response to metabolic fluctuations and ensuring stable physiological glucose levels throughout the day. This method remains a cornerstone for inpatient care and intensive insulin therapy protocols.

Diabetes Injection Site Rotation Tracker

Diabetes Injection Site Rotation Tracker

💾 Diabetes Injection Site Rotation Tracker .xls

A Diabetes Injection Site Rotation Tracker is an essential tool for optimizing insulin therapy and maintaining skin integrity. By systematically documenting delivery locations across the subcutaneous tissue of the abdomen, thighs, upper arms, and buttocks, patients can effectively prevent lipohypertrophy. This hardened fatty tissue often results from repeated injections in the same area, leading to erratic insulin absorption and compromised glycemic control.

Utilizing a structured rotation map ensures consistent blood glucose management and promotes long-term tissue health. This template helps track daily patterns, reducing the risk of site soreness and scarring. Implementing a disciplined rotation strategy allows for better predictability in metabolic response, making it a cornerstone of effective diabetes self-management. Consistent site variation is vital for maximizing the efficacy of every dose and stabilizing overall health outcomes through precise glucose monitoring.

Intensive Insulin Therapy Worksheet

Intensive Insulin Therapy Worksheet

💾 Intensive Insulin Therapy Worksheet .xls

An Intensive Insulin Therapy Worksheet serves as a precise management tool for individuals utilizing multiple daily injections or insulin pump therapy. This structured document organizes vital data points to help calculate the exact dosage required to maintain blood glucose within a specific target range.

The template typically includes the following critical elements:

  • Insulin-to-Carbohydrate Ratios: Guidelines for determining mealtime bolus doses based on grams of carbohydrates consumed.
  • Correction Factors: Specific calculations used to lower high blood glucose levels back to the desired objective.
  • Daily Logs: Dedicated space for recording glucose readings, physical activity, and nutritional intake.

By utilizing this systematic approach, patients and healthcare providers can identify patterns, refine treatment variables, and improve overall glycemic control. This structured format ensures that every adjustment is based on documented clinical evidence and individual metabolic responses.
